Job Description
Summary: Benesch is a growing, multi-disciplined planning, engineering, and professional services firm. They are seeking a Structural Engineering Intern to support bridge and structure design, load ratings, and bridge inspections while gaining hands-on experience and mentorship from experienced engineers.
Responsibilities:
- Support conventional and complex bridge and structure design, load ratings, and bridge inspections
- Gain hands-on experience contributing to design, analysis, and field tasks while learning directly from experienced engineers
Required Qualifications:
- Pursuing a bachelor's degree in Civil Engineering from an ABET-accredited university, focusing on structures
- Strong interest in bridge and structural engineering
- Excellent analytical, technical, and communication skills (written and verbal)
- Ability to work effectively in a team environment
- Strong organizational and problem-solving skills
Preferred Qualifications:
- Master's degree in Civil Engineering with a structural focus (or plans to obtain within 2 years)
- Familiarity with AASHTO, IDOT, and ISTHA design and construction standards
